Mommy’s Shabbat Challah

3 packages dry yeast
1 ½ cup warm water
½ cup oil
4 eggs + 1 for egg wash
2 tsp. salt
1 cup sugar
8 cups flour + extra for your hands
Mix yeast and warm water, make sure it bubbles. Mix the eggs, oil, salt and sugar one ingredient at a time until well blended. Add flour. Knead with your hands for 5-7 minutes.
Set in a bowl and cover with a towel in a warm place for 1-2 hours, then punch it down and let it rise again for another 1-2 hours. If in a rush you can skip this second rise! Braid, brush the top with egg wash (egg yolk mixed with water). Bake at 350 degrees for 25-35 minutes.

Salad Dressing Chicken
1 whole chicken cut into pieces
Salt and pepper
½ bottle of Pareve (oil based) Italian Salad dressing
Place chicken in a pyrex dish or baking sheet. Add salt and pepper then pour over salad dressing. Bake at 375 degrees for an hour.

Gram’s Matzo Balls
6 eggs
1 ½ cups matzo mela
1 tsp. Baking powder
Salt and pepper to taste
6 tablespoons soup stock
Mix together and let sit for 1 hour in refrigerator. Bring water to a boil. Form into balls with well oiled hands. Drop into boiling water and let simmer for 45 minutes.

Quick & Delicious Cupcakes
½ lb. margarine
1 cup milk
3 cups flour
3 tsp. baking powder
1 tsp. Vanilla
1 ½ cups sugar
4 eggs
Cream together the margarine and sugar. Add eggs, the dry ingredients, milk and vanilla. Beat until smooth. Bake at 350 degrees for 45 minutes or 15-20 minutes if you are making cupcakes.
